Sharkninja - Needham, MA

posted 24 days ago

Full-time - Mid Level
Needham, MA
Electrical Equipment, Appliance, and Component Manufacturing

About the position

The Mobile App Manager at SharkNinja is responsible for leading the development, launch, and ongoing management of mobile applications, particularly those integrated with connected devices. This role requires a strategic thinker with expertise in mobile technology and user experience, aiming to enhance app performance and user engagement while aligning with business objectives.

Responsibilities

  • Oversee the entire mobile app lifecycle from concept to deployment and updates, focusing on integration with connected devices.
  • Collaborate with cross-functional teams (design, development, marketing) to define app features and functionality tailored for IoT applications.
  • Ensure adherence to best practices in app development, UI/UX design, and quality assurance.
  • Analyze user feedback and app performance metrics to identify areas for improvement, especially in functionalities related to connected devices.
  • Develop and implement strategies to increase user acquisition, retention, and engagement.
  • Monitor app store reviews and ratings, responding to user feedback as necessary.
  • Conduct competitive analysis to identify trends and opportunities in the connected devices mobile app market.
  • Stay updated on industry trends, emerging technologies, and best practices in mobile app and connected devices development.
  • Lead and mentor a team of developers across various skillsets and experience.
  • Coordinate with stakeholders to ensure alignment on app goals and priorities.
  • Manage project timelines effectively.

Requirements

  • Bachelor's degree in Computer Science, Information Technology, or a related field.
  • 5+ years of professional experience in mobile app development.
  • Experience leading a mobile development team or project with other developers.
  • Proven experience in mobile app management.
  • Strong understanding of mobile app development processes, tools, and technologies.
  • Experience coding in Swift (iOS), Kotlin or Java (Android), or React Native.
  • Experience with Typescript and JavaScript development.
  • Familiarity with HTTP(s) and BLE protocols and frameworks.
  • Experience with analytics tools (e.g., Google Analytics, Firebase) to track app performance.
  • Excellent communication and interpersonal skills, with the ability to work collaboratively across teams.
  • Strong problem-solving skills and a results-oriented mindset.

Nice-to-haves

  • Master's degree in a relevant field.
  • Experience with Agile project management methodologies.
  • Experience with Rust.

Benefits

  • Diversity, Equity, and Inclusion initiatives
  • Career acceleration opportunities
  • Support for authentic self-expression at work
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service